Hey Beach: How a Handwritten Font Became My Secret Weapon for Campaign Visuals

The 9 AM Panic: Designing for a Summer Product Launch

It was 9:03 AM and the summer product launch visuals were still missing something. The mockups looked clean, the color palette was on brand, but the headlines felt flat. I cycled through font options trying to find the right tone—something playful but professional, casual yet confident. That’s when I opened the Hey Beach preview.

Hey Beach is a Script Amp font designed with a warm, handwritten charm that instantly adds personality. It’s not overly decorative, which makes it perfect for digital marketing where clarity and character need to work together. I dropped it into the main headline of the campaign banner and saw the shift immediately—more approachable, more human.

From Thumbnails to Social Posts: Where Hey Beach Shines

I used Hey Beach across multiple touchpoints: YouTube thumbnails, Instagram Stories, Pinterest pins, and email banners. Each platform has its own visual rhythm, but the font held its own across all of them. For the YouTube thumbnails, I used it in a bold layout with a sun graphic behind it—perfect for a summer skincare line. On Pinterest, I layered it over pastel backgrounds for quote-based pins that felt personal and inviting.

What I found was that Hey Beach works best for short, punchy text. It’s not ideal for long paragraphs, but as a headline or callout font, it grabs attention without overwhelming the viewer. I used it for taglines like “Feel the Summer Vibes” and “New Launch Alert” and saw a noticeable improvement in visual flow.

Message Clarity and Campaign Consistency

In fast-scrolling feeds, the first impression matters. Hey Beach’s casual style adds a sense of warmth and authenticity that resonates with younger audiences. I made sure to pair it with a clean sans serif for body copy to maintain readability and visual hierarchy. The contrast between the handwritten charm of Hey Beach and the crisp structure of the sans serif helped guide the eye naturally.

For a webinar promotion I was designing, I used Hey Beach as the title font on the registration banner. It gave the event a friendly, approachable feel—perfect for a session called “Summer Marketing Hacks.” The font also scaled well on mobile previews, which was a big win since most of our audience would see it on their phones.

Real Campaign Examples That Worked

For an Instagram content series promoting a new line of beachwear, I used Hey Beach as the main text overlay on carousel images. Each post had a different color scheme, but the consistent use of the font tied the visuals together. One post with the text “Your Summer Look Starts Here” got more saves and shares than any other in the series.

In a separate email campaign for a seasonal sale, we used Hey Beach for the header: “Up to 50% Off—End of Season Blowout.” It stood out in the inbox and helped reinforce the friendly, limited-time tone of the message. The font gave the campaign a more boutique-style feel, which aligned with the brand’s personality.

Font Pairing Made Easy

One of the biggest design wins with Hey Beach was how easily it paired with other fonts. I used it alongside a minimalist serif for packaging mockups and even layered it over a second script font in a limited way for a branded quote graphic. The key was to let Hey Beach be the standout element while supporting it with more neutral typography.

For a landing page header, I used Hey Beach for the main headline and a bold sans serif for the subheader. The result was a clean, modern layout with a touch of warmth. It felt intentional without being overdesigned.

Technical Notes Every Marketer Should Know

Before using Hey Beach in any client or commercial project, I double-checked the licensing—it’s important to ensure the font can be used in digital ads, templates, and branded content. I also made sure to review the included styles, ligatures, and alternate characters to get the most out of the design flexibility.

The font comes in multiple file formats, which made it easy to use across design tools like Canva, Photoshop, and Figma. Multilingual support was another plus, especially since part of the campaign included Spanish-language assets.
